Default Would a fuel system for a turbo setup be good for others???

Ok, if I upgrade my fuel system, say a Sumped tank, -8 line, Bosch 420l pump and inline filter, regulator and rails, with some XXX# injectors and use the stock line as a return, would this be just as good for a turbo as a SC? I know a nice Nitrous set up wouldnt argue with it, but would be way way way over kill.

The fuel system is the best place for overkill for safety. IMHO over 550rwhp needs a supply line, rails, return line, properly sized injectors, wire kit and a single Walbro intank up to 600rwhp and a dual Walbro intank over 600 rwhp. It's overkill but you'll never kill the engine due to low fuel pressure/lean condition.

I would have to disagree with one part you stated..... A single Walbro would be good for lower rwhp but twins....... no. The reason is if one pump goes out you would never know it in normal driving fuel pressure would be fine..... until you floored it at the track and when you needed it most its not there.

Charlie with the big pump you quoted you shoud have more then enough pump. Bigbos and myself are using that pump and for some reason its not working you will know and you dont have to cut a hole in your car or drop the tank to fix it.

There's a bunch of dual Walbro users that would also disagree.

I agree that one pump would keep it simple....but how would you know if the pumping capacity starts to fall off on the single pump? When they start to fail some don't cease to pump....they pump less and you go lean. Same problem with a secondary pump failing....you really need an A/F guage.
